Witryna24 sty 2024 · Here are the two chemical equations that show you how the hydroxide anion present in an aqueous NaOH solution acts as a Brønsted-Lowry base: This shows that adding NaOH to water lowers the hydrogen ion concentration (i.e. raising the pH) by hydroxide reacting with hydronium ions to form water. Witryna6 lip 2024 · Sodium hydroxide (NaOH) solution or solid (to adjust pH) Procedure Stir 186.1 g disodium ethylenediaminetetraacetate•2H 2 O into 800 ml of distilled water. Stir the solution vigorously using a magnetic stirrer.
